Higher Education Department Government of Punjab – Directorate of Education (Colleges) Rawalpindi Division (Punjab Higher Education Department Rawalpindi Division Job Postings 2022) will be recruiting staff for Grade IV vacancies.

Rawalpindi Division Directorate of Education (Colleges) is currently accepting applications for Government Colleges under Punjab Higher Education Division in Rawalpindi Division.

 

These vacancies are available in Rawalpindi, Attock, Jhelum and Chakwal. The list of open colleges has been announced in the notification. In this way, candidates can get information about the open quota in the nearby college.

Job Post 2022 Announcement

Vacancies are advertised for both genders (male/female), with quotas for the disabled and minorities. Candidates from all over Punjab are welcome to apply, but preference will be given to residents of respective counties.

Government Colleges Rawalpindi Division is looking for Drivers, Naib Kasid, Lab Assistant, Mali, Beldar, Watchman, Groundsman, Waterman, Bus Driver and Class IV.

Fit and physically fit candidates between the age of 18 to 40 years can submit their information as selected applicants from these Class IV posts.

Eligibility Criteria and Skills for Jobs:

Applicants meet the following criteria.
The age limit is 18 to 40 years old.
Education: literate
Candidates must have a domicile in the constituency concerned and carry an identity card.
Information on the recruitment calendar can be obtained from the departmental directorates of national education of all the departments concerned.
All applicants are required to submit a statement that they are/are not wanted/not named in an FIR.

Authorities competent to receive applications:

The relevant senior/upper secondary schools (boys/girls) will collect applications for the merit slots available in the upper secondary schools.
Submit an application to the Deputy District Education Officer for the appropriate Tehsil for merit positions available in primary schools (male or female).
Applications for the Disabled Quota, Women’s Quota, Minority Quota, and In-Service/Retired positions will be received from the District Offices of National Education.
